Transaction c32d8448315f31dc190decf08fda66fa2ef3d1445dee4e09695c20e309363eb8
1 Input
2 Outputs
- c32d8448315f31dc190decf08fda66fa2ef3d1445dee4e09695c20e309363eb8:0
- c32d8448315f31dc190decf08fda66fa2ef3d1445dee4e09695c20e309363eb8:1
value 1672454534
address 154S4GK5c4C4Lbsnn5CQsQBwj8Kmaswfee
value 24130000
address 3FfXsVahk7YQAfpd2KNn4QYyJS6ws8y81b